Stock Car Brasil, also known as Stock Car V8, is a touring car auto racing series based in Brazil. It is considered the major South American motorsports series and was inaugurated in 1979.
Subject ID: 100097
MoreStock Car Brasil, also known as Stock Car V8, is a touring car auto racing series based in Brazil. It is considered the major South American motorsports series and was inaugurated in 1979.
Subject ID: 100097
Subject ID: 100097
We're trying to keep access to hobbyDB free forever, so we use ads to help offset the costs of running the site.
Please consider disabling your ad blocker to support our mission.
If you have feedback, feel free to contact us!
Click to continue without supporting hobbyDB
If the prompt is still appearing, please disable any tools or services you are using that block internet ads (e.g. DNS Servers).